Lines Matching refs:sectors
68 sector_t curr_zone_end, sectors; in create_strip_zones() local
88 sectors = rdev1->sectors; in create_strip_zones()
89 sector_div(sectors, mddev->chunk_sectors); in create_strip_zones()
90 rdev1->sectors = sectors * mddev->chunk_sectors; in create_strip_zones()
101 (unsigned long long)rdev1->sectors, in create_strip_zones()
103 (unsigned long long)rdev2->sectors); in create_strip_zones()
109 if (rdev2->sectors == rdev1->sectors) { in create_strip_zones()
198 if (!smallest || (rdev1->sectors < smallest->sectors)) in create_strip_zones()
208 zone->zone_end = smallest->sectors * cnt; in create_strip_zones()
221 zone->dev_start = smallest->sectors; in create_strip_zones()
227 if (rdev->sectors <= zone->dev_start) { in create_strip_zones()
239 if (!smallest || rdev->sectors < smallest->sectors) { in create_strip_zones()
243 (unsigned long long)rdev->sectors); in create_strip_zones()
248 sectors = (smallest->sectors - zone->dev_start) * c; in create_strip_zones()
251 zone->nb_dev, (unsigned long long)sectors); in create_strip_zones()
253 curr_zone_end += sectors; in create_strip_zones()
258 (unsigned long long)smallest->sectors); in create_strip_zones()
357 static sector_t raid0_size(struct mddev *mddev, sector_t sectors, int raid_disks) in raid0_size() argument
362 WARN_ONCE(sectors || raid_disks, in raid0_size()
366 array_sectors += (rdev->sectors & in raid0_size()
597 unsigned sectors; in raid0_make_request() local
611 sectors = chunk_sects - in raid0_make_request()
616 if (sectors < bio_sectors(bio)) { in raid0_make_request()
617 bio = bio_submit_split_bioset(bio, sectors, in raid0_make_request()
662 rdev->sectors = mddev->dev_sectors; in raid0_takeover_raid45()